I am currently working on a fracture simulation in houdini. I need to have some liquid interact with the fracture sim, and I figured for fun I would try to use Bifrost within Maya. I wrote out my fracture sim as a digital asset and promoted the parameters I needed so I real time can adjust those accordingly to the rest of the scene. This is working perfectly until I start simulating my liquid with the Bifrost Engine. I have added my fracture sim as a collider, and told bifrost that this is an animated collider.

My problem is as soon as my bifrost particles collides with my houdini fracture sim it crashed the bifrost engine.

Alternatively I have tried caching out the fracture sim so it is not Live from houdini while I simulate with bifrost, but I cannot get Bifrost to interact with the animated collison objects.
